A lot of Tottenham Hotspur fans have taken to Twitter to voice their thoughts on the latest transfer rumour to emerge ahead of this summer’s transfer window. 

Manchester City striker Sergio Aguero has announced he will be leaving the club in the summer, and The Telegraph has reported the Argentine would be open to a move to Spurs.

Tottenham’s Harry Kane is also being linked with a move away this summer, with Manchester City reported to be interested in the 27-year-old.

The north London side were believed to be in the running for the Argentine striker in the past, however, he made the move from Atletico Madrid to City in the summer of 2011 instead.

Aguero has struggled with injuries this season and as a result, the 32-year-old has only made nine appearances in the Premier League – scoring just once (via Transfermarkt).

Going off the replies from the Spurs fans, it seems they would be happy to see Aguero join in the summer as a backup to Harry Kane with the future of Carlos Vinicius unknown as his loan deal is set to end at the conclusion of this season.
